Dungeon Magic: Light Bringer came out on the Nintendo Entertainment System in 1989, developed by Natsume. It was part of that wave of late 80s action RPGs that tried to capture the dungeon-crawling spirit of games like Zelda, but with its own particular flavor and a focus on cooperative play.
You control a lone hero, or team up with a friend, to explore a large, multi-level dungeon in a search for the Light Bringer sword. The game progresses screen by screen, with each new area often locking you in until you defeat all the enemies that appear. Combat is straightforward; you swing your sword or use secondary weapons like a bow, which you have to find hidden in the environment. The real challenge comes from the traps and the sheer number of foes, making progress feel deliberate and sometimes punishing. It feels like a methodical, sometimes frustrating, but always earnest crawl through a dangerous place.
